Transformer Selection for Grid-Tied PV Systems

Apr 16, 2024· In this scenario, the PV system is exporting power to the grid. The transformer will need to accommodate, e.g. step down the voltage: from 480 V along the inverter circuit to provide 208 V to the utility side circuit. In this context, the transformer will be energized first from the utility side, and the inverter side second.

How to Protect Solar Inverter from Sun: Top Tips and Tricks

Aug 12, 2023· From strategic locations to creating a solar inverter cover, we''ve got you covered. Suitable Locations for Solar Inverter Installation. If possible, your solar inverter should be installed in a shaded location, out of direct sunlight. A north-facing wall or a garage are good locations in most climates. How do inverters connect to electrical panels?

Circuit breaker connection: The AC wires from the inverter connect to the electrical panel through a circuit breaker. This is the most common type of connection with residential systems and is always allowed by utilities. It is also used with commercial applications whenever the main panel can accommodate the PV backfeed current.

Disconnect requirements in a Solar PV system | Information by

May 9, 2011· The only question I have about the inverter disconnect is 690.14(1) which states the disconnect should be at the nearest point of entrance of the PV system conductors. In my case the conductors enter the building from the roof but may have to travel inside the parking garage for a little bit before they get to the inverter on the lower level.

Solar Transformers: Sizing, Inverters, and E-Shields

May 29, 2024· Renewable generation sources (like solar) interact with transformers in a unique way. At startup, power is fed from the utility to the solar inverter. Once the inverter receives a balanced voltage input, the solar side feeds back into the grid. The transformer plays the role of a step up and step down unit.

Inverter, Meter, and Shut-Off Mounting Surface for Solar PV

Solar PV system inverters can be quite heavy (>80 pounds), necessitating a solid backing to mount the inverter. To meet the requirement for the DOE Zero Energy Ready Home program, a 4ft x 4ft piece of finished plywood should be mounted near the electrical service panel for the PV balance of system components, including the inverter, meters and

Can an inverter be placed anywhere on a solar PV system?

Therefore an inverter output to 50A (125% of rated output current) can be placed anywhere on the bus because the sum of both sources would be 200A. Since the bus is rated for 200A, there is no potential for overload. Downsizing the main can be used in combination with the 120% rule to connect larger solar PV systems.
